CONFIG_BT_CTLR_CONN_META

Enable connection meta data extension

Type: bool

Help

Enables vendor specific per-connection meta data as part of the LLL connection object.

Direct dependencies

BT_LL_SW_SPLIT && BT_CTLR && BT_HCI && BT

(Includes any dependencies from ifs and menus.)

Defaults

No defaults. Implicitly defaults to n.
